I did a search for the models I am having trouble with, but didn't find
anything in the lists so forgive me if these have already been discussed:
Soundblaster Live
-Seems to have detected and configured, but no sound is played either by
test or by an audio CD
Network Everywhere NC100
-Put in PC after FC2 was installed, seemed to install drivers but
wouldn't get a DHCP address
-Deleted the configuration and now after installing it gives a modprobe
error when trying to activate saying "tulip device not present"
-Manually assigning an IP address in the proper subnet space to lo
allows for communication
